#bnera a.b1 { width: 154px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) 0px 0px no-repeat; }
#bnera a.b1: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  0px 0px no-repeat; }
#bnera a.b2 { width: 160px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) -146px 0px no-repeat; }
#bnera a.b2: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  -146px 0px no-repeat; }
#bnera a.b3 { width: 160px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) -307px 0px no-repeat; }
#bnera a.b3: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  -307px 0px no-repeat; }
#bnera a.b4 { width: 160px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) -468px 0px no-repeat; }
#bnera a.b4: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  -468px 0px no-repeat; }
#bnera a.b5 { width: 160px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) -629px 0px no-repeat; }
#bnera a.b5: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  -629px 0px no-repeat; }
#bnera a.b6 { width: 160px; border-right: solid 1px #eee; margin: 0; background: url(/cdn/all/botonera_off2.jpg) -790px 0px no-repeat; }
#bnera a.b6:hover { 												 background: url(/cdn/all/botonera_on2.jpg)  -790px 0px no-repeat; }

/* OJO CUANDO HAYA MENOS BOTONES */

.footer-links { height: 31px; min-height: 31px; }
.footer-links a { display: inline-block; height: 31px; min-height: 31px; }
.footer-links a.ftr1 { width: 240px; margin: 0; 	background: url(/cdn/es/pie_vkoff.jpg) 0px 0px no-repeat; }
.footer-links a.ftr1:hover { 						background: url(/cdn/es/pie_vkon.jpg)  0px 0px no-repeat; }
.footer-links a.ftr2 { width: 240px; margin: 0; 	background: url(/cdn/es/pie_vkoff.jpg) -240px 0px no-repeat; }
.footer-links a.ftr2:hover { 						background: url(/cdn/es/pie_vkon.jpg)  -240px 0px no-repeat; }
.footer-links a.ftr3 { width: 240px; margin: 0; 	background: url(/cdn/es/pie_vkoff.jpg) -480px 0px no-repeat; }
.footer-links a.ftr3:hover { 						background: url(/cdn/es/pie_vkon.jpg)  -480px 0px no-repeat; }
.footer-links a.ftr4 { width: 240px; margin: 0; 	background: url(/cdn/es/pie_vkoff.jpg) -720px 0px no-repeat; }
.footer-links a.ftr4:hover { 						background: url(/cdn/es/pie_vkon.jpg)  -720px 0px no-repeat; }

/* Header Master Page */
#headerContainer1 {margin-top: 13px; width: 550px;}
#telefonoHeader {background: url("/cdn/all/telefono.png") no-repeat scroll 0% 0% transparent; width: 235px; margin-left: 165px; margin-right: 180px;}
#telefonoHeader span.phones {font-size: 1.2em; margin-top:10px;color: #000000; padding-right:15px; line-height:22px; font-weight:bold; font-family:sans-serif;}
.phone-stgo,
.phone-stodgo { position: relative; }
.phone-stgo:before,
.phone-stodgo:before {
	position: absolute;
	bottom: -17px;
	font-size: 80%;
}
.phone-stgo:before {
	content: "Santiago";
	left: 18px;
}
.phone-stodgo:before {
	content: "Santo Domingo";
	right: 0px;
}
#Contactar {float: right; background: url(/cdn/all/atencion_cliente.png) no-repeat -1px 1px; padding-left: 45px; margin-left: 45px;font-weight:bold;color:#c00;font-size:1.1em;text-align:left;line-height:50px; margin-top:-42px;}
#Contactar span {font-size: 0.9em; text-align:center; margin-right:15px;}
#emailContactar {background: url("/cdn/all/mail.png") no-repeat scroll 3px 6px transparent; font-weight: bold; line-height: 23px; text-align: left; padding-left: 25px; margin-left: -60px; margin-top: -7px;font-size: 1em;}

.nxtBookingFareDetail tr.hiddenRow { display: none; }

/* Banner facebook*/
.banner {background:#e5c48e url(../Images/content/bannerfb.jpg) repeat top left; position:relative; width:310px; display:block; border:#d6d6d6 1px solid;  padding-top:100px; -webkit-border-radius:8px; -moz-border-radius:8px; border-radius:8px; -webkit-box-shadow:#666 1px 2px 3px; -webkit-box-shadow:#d9d9d9 1px 2px 2px; -moz-box-shadow:#d9d9d9 1px 2px 2px; box-shadow:#d9d9d9 1px 2px 2px; }
.banner h4 {background:url(../Images/Components/back_3.gif) repeat-x  #E12930; color:#FFF; border-top:2px solid #FFF; width:310; padding:5px; text-align:center; font-size:20px; display:block; bottom:0; -webkit-border-radius:0 0 8px 8px; -moz-border-radius:0 0 8px 8px; border-radius:0 0 8px 8px; position:relative;}

/* Banner instagram*/
.bannerinstagram {background:#e5c48e url(../Images/content/instagram.png) repeat top left; position:relative; width:310px; display:block; border:#d6d6d6 1px solid;  padding-top:110px; -webkit-border-radius:8px; -moz-border-radius:8px; border-radius:8px; -webkit-box-shadow:#666 1px 2px 3px; -webkit-box-shadow:#d9d9d9 1px 2px 2px; -moz-box-shadow:#d9d9d9 1px 2px 2px; box-shadow:#d9d9d9 1px 2px 2px; }


